Welcome to Quarrelsome Data. All SQL files must pass sqlfleck before merge: uppercase keywords, snake_case identifiers, no SELECT *, trailing commas forbidden. Run `make lint-sql` locally; CI blocks violations. Config lives in `.sqlfleck.toml` — don't edit it without approval from the Pipeline Guild. To push lint-fix commits to the shared branch, use the deploy key below.

deploy key for kajof-fajop: bky6_gDHw9Q

# Client setup for the Fernwick thumbnail generation queue.
# As discussed at the weekly eng sync: this worker pulls render jobs
# from the Oakline queue service, generates thumbnails at three sizes,
# and writes results back with a content hash. Retries are capped at
# five with exponential backoff; anything beyond that lands in the
# dead-letter topic for manual review. The client authenticates to
# Oakline using the internal service key directly below this comment.

app token of yajeg-kawef = kto11_7En3XSX8xQw

Prefetcher for the Wayfarer map client. Pulls tiles around the viewport along the predicted pan vector. Aggressiveness is a tradeoff: too eager and we blow the device cache and cell-data budget; too lazy and users see gray tiles on fast pans. Field telemetry from the Q3 rollout drove the current settings — do not tweak without rerunning the pan-latency benchmark. Raising the ring radius past two has never paid off. For discussion at the sync, the constants in force are as follows.

constants for bawif-kawif:
QUOTAS = {
    "ulaael": 5,
    "holael": 10,
}